O P I N I O N 0 4: # 0 0 0 0 % 0 0 0 0 0 SEXTON, - CHAIRMAN 1 On May 3, 1943, Applicant Las Vegas Land k Water Company filed with the Commission Second Revised Sheet w •M. 6A cancelling First Revised Sheet P.8 .C.N. 6A, to Become effective June 3, 1943, wherein applicant seeks to cancel Rule 9{c) of its rules and regulations. Rule 9(c) Became effective January 29, 1942, and reads as follows: -1-
